Historic Irene Hill-Thompson House, Landmark of Black History, Designated As Landmark

Preservation Austinis thrilled to announce that Austin City Council designated the Hill-Thompson House as a City of Austin Landmark at their May 28 meeting. The residence, located at 1906 Maple Avenue, was designed by pioneering Black architect John S. Chase, FAIA, for civic leader Irene Hill-Thompson, widow of Oscar Thompson, the first Black student to graduate from The University of Texas at Austin.
